JC Lindsay Scottish Junior Open 2018

This seasons competition introduces a new venue and will be played from Oriam, Scotland’s Sports Performance Centre which is based at Heriot-Watt Univeristy. This is the first time the venue has been used for the event since the opening of the extension in 2016, creating Scotland’s Sports Performance Centre. Scottish Squash look forward to delivering the event from the new venue and alongside Edinburgh Sports Club who host for their third year and create a fantastic atmosphere throughout the competition.

The competition will run from Friday 28th December – Sunday 30th December 2018.

Scottish Squash are extremely delighted to announce that JC Lindsay have confirmed they will sponsor the event for a third year with Eye Rackets being a key partner in the successful delivery of the 2018 competition.

Scottish Squash’s National Coach Paul Bell said: “The JC Lindsay Scottish Junior Open is a rare opportunity for all the Scottish Squash players to compete at such a high level on home soil.  The event is going from strength to strength and we hope by moving the date to before the British Junior Open will encourage even more of the world’s top juniors to compete.  Scotland is on the rise in terms of junior squash and the opportunity for our young players to test themselves against the worlds best will provide a great indicator of just how far they have come.”

The date between Christmas and New Year will allow players to travel to the UK to compete in the JC Lindsay Scottish Junior Open prior to the Dunlop British Junior Open which takes place in Birmingham from 2nd – 6th January 2019. Scottish Squash are proud to announce they are working in partnership with England Squash to support players to be able to play in the JC Lindsay Scottish Junior Open and Dunlop British Junior Open shortly after.
